Evaluating Ecuador’s Squad strengths and Tournament Strategies

The roster selected by Ecuador features a blend of youthful talent alongside seasoned players—creating a strategic combination that could carry them through various stages of Copa América™. Notable figures like Enner Valenciaand rising stars such asMoisés Caicedohighlight this dual approach: leveraging veteran experience while embracing youthful dynamism.
This strategy may prove crucial during high-pressure situations,as balancing agility with experienced decision-making will be vital when facing tough competitors.
